Dr. Andrea Ortiz receives the WWTF Vienna Research Group (VRG) Grant (1.6 Mio) which is linked to a tenure track professorship position at the Institute of Telecommunications at TU Wien starting in 2024. The project’s aim is to establish a new research group on sustainable, scalable and resilient wireless networks.
